PFAS
Deuter does not disclose water-repellent coating chemistry; most polyester duffels of this era use fluorinated water-repellent finishes. Risk level is moderate because exposure is dermal contact and minor, not ingestion; however, accumulation in the environment and bioaccumulation are documented concerns for PFAS compounds.
Source, ATSDR ↗Antimony in polyester
Antimony is sometimes used as a catalyst in polyester production. Deuter does not disclose antimony content or mitigation. Antimony leaching from polyester is generally minimal in non-food, dry-use applications like duffels, but it remains a low-level concern if the bag is wet and in prolonged contact with skin.
Microplastics
As the water-repellent coating wears over years of use and washing, small particles may shed into wash water and the environment. This is not a direct health hazard to the user, but contributes to microplastic pollution; no brand-specific testing or claim available for Deuter.

What it's made of and why it matters
The Deuter Duffel Pro 60 is constructed from polyester fabric with a water-repellent coating (water-repellent coating) coating applied to the exterior. Polyester itself is a stable synthetic polymer with low chemical leaching risk during normal use. However, water-repellent coating finishes historically rely on fluorinated compounds (PFAS or PFAS-alternatives) to repel water, and Deuter does not publicly disclose which chemistry they use on this model, leaving the specific PFAS risk unquantified.
The brand's record and disclosure
Deuter is a German outdoor equipment manufacturer with a general reputation for durability and functional design. The brand has not published a comprehensive PFAS policy or transparency report regarding their water-repellent treatments, nor have they committed to phasing out legacy PFAS. No major textile safety recalls or hazard alerts have been publicly recorded for Deuter products in the duffel/pack category.
How it compares in its category
Among mid-to-premium polyester duffels, the Deuter Pro 60 sits in a category where most competitors similarly use polyester with water-repellent coating coatings and rarely disclose PFAS status. Some brands (e.g., Patagonia, The North Face) have begun publishing water-repellent coating chemistry or transitioning to alternatives not linked to PFAS; Deuter has not yet made such commitments public. The lack of disclosure is fairly typical for this price and product tier, not exceptional.
If you buy it
Wash the duffel in cool water by hand or gentle machine cycle; avoid prolonged soaking or hot water, which can degrade the water-repellent coating. Do not dry-clean or use fabric softeners, as these can strip the water-repellent finish. Expect the water-repellent coating to diminish after 5-10 years or ~50-100 wash cycles; re-application products are available if you wish to restore water resistance. Store in a dry place away from direct heat to minimize any potential off-gassing from the polyester and coating.
